#2ecf02 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2ecf02 is composed of 18% red, 81.2%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 99%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 107.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 41%. #2ecf02 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ff04 with #009f00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#2ecf02

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d00 is the darkest color, while #fafff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ecf02

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656f62 is the less saturated color, while #2ecf02 is the most saturated one.
